Recording Videos to Discs

Copy the files that are arranged using the user list to DVDs.
GZ-HD500
You can create only AVCHD discs using the provided application
software.
To create DVD-Video discs, refer to "Dubbing Files to a DVD Recorder
or VCR" A P.84) .
Using the optional application software, you can create DVD-Video and
BD discs on a computer.
Download the optional software here
http://www.pixela.co.jp/oem/jvc/mediabrowser/e/purchase_dl/media-
browser_hd_2/
1
Insert a new disc into the PC's recordable DVD drive.
2
Select the desired user list.
3
Select the disc type (GZ-HD620 only).
4
Select the method of file selection.
If you select "Select all files displayed", only the displayed videos are
copied to the disc.
Proceed to step 6.
If you select "Select files individually", proceed to step 5.
5
(When "Select files individually" is selected) Select the files to copy to
disc in order.
6
Set the top menu of the disc.
Set the title and menu background.
7
Copying to disc starts.
